Comprehending the Incline Feature
Incline on treadmills describes the capability to adjust the angle of the running surface area to replicate uphill running or walking. A lot of contemporary running makers included adjustable incline settings, varying from 0% to upwards of 15% or more. This function creates a range of workout intensities, using users the flexibility required to tailor their training according to personal goals and physical fitness levels.

Treadmill Workout Ideas with Incline
To truly reap the advantages of a running machine with an incline, users can incorporate various workouts into their regimens. Here are a couple of concepts:

Hill Intervals: Alternate between low and high inclines. For example:
5 minutes at a 0% incline3 minutes at a 5% incline5 minutes at a 0% incline3 minutes at a 10% inclineRepeat as preferred.
Steady-State Incline Run: Choose a moderate however challenging incline (4-6%) and run at a stable pace for 20-30 minutes. This workout enhances endurance and builds endurance.

Incline Walk: For low-impact cardio, walk at a considerable incline (8-15%) at a vigorous speed. This session can last 30-60 minutes and is ideal for those recuperating from injuries.

Pace Runs: Warm up with a 5-minute jog at 0% incline. Then alternate between a 5% incline run and a quicker speed on a flat surface area. For instance:
